TC does not find any entry at your wincmd.ini file.

Possible reasons:
1. There are no entries at [PackerPlugins] section of your active wincmd.ini file (see "Help - About Total Commander")
2. Your wincmd.ini file is on a network share and could not read it on startup (using a fresh and empty ini instead)
